Do I Really Need To Write Articles For E-zines?

When I was first advised to start writing articles, this was the first question I asked. As I was totally freaked out at the thought of me writing for others to read.

Many people subscribe to e-zines and the readers often trust the recommendation of their editors. By sending articles to e-zines you will get valued visitors to your web-site. For each article you get published by them, the traffic to your website is increased.

What is there to gain from publishing e-zine articles?

At the end of your article you can add a resource box. With this you can brand your web site, business and yourself. In it you could include your name, business name, web site address, e-mail address, anything really that brands your business.

Become a GURU! By publishing regularly you will become known as an expert on the topics you write about. This gives you an advantage that helps you compete by giving you and your business extra credibility.

Some articles are placed on a publisher's home page. If each issue is placed on their home page you can gain extra exposure. If your publisher archives their e-zine, in other words stores back copies. This again gives you greater exposure; it is good for the sceptics in that they can read previous articles before making the decision to subscribe.

Free advertising!! It costs you nothing to have that resource box displayed on each article you publish. You can then spend your profits on other forms of advertising.

You never know, your articles may well inspire others to hire you to write articles, e-books. What a great way to multiply your income.

By allowing e-zine publishers to publish your articles in their free e-books, your advertising could multiply all over the internet. Simply because people give them away. We all like something for free.

Using an e-zine publisher that has a free content directory on their web site gets your article published all over the web. They'll allow their visitors to republish your article. Remember you will still have your resource box at the end of your article. That's branding!!

You'll gain people's trust, particularly if you area regular publisher. Like most people if they like they'll read it. They won't be as hesitant to buy your product or service.

Now you can see the benefits, it's time to write that article. In fact write one a month and submit it to e-zine directories. You'll be glad you did.
